What is Mitragyna Hirsuta?

Mitragyna hirsuta

Mitragyna hirsuta is a popular Kratom alternative. It comes from the same genus and plant family as the Kratom plant. Scientific name for Kratom is Mitragyna speciosa. They both share common properties. This plant is native to the jungles of Vietnam, Thailand, and Malaysia. 

Mitragyna hirsuta is also known as “Kra Thum Khok” which is the street name. The leaves of these plants are slightly smaller than the Kratom ones. The leaves have light green to dark-colored veins with a dark green lamina.

Difference Between Mitragyna Hirsuta and Mitragyna Javanica

Mitragyna hirsuta

Mitragyna hirsuta is often confused with Mitragyna javanica. Javanica is another herb from the same genus family, Mitragyna. Let us see how both of these differ.

Mitragyna javanica is known as Kratom’s sister plant. It contains significant concentrations of mitrajavine, an alkaloid. It also contains certain proportions of ajmalicine and 3-isoajmalicin. These two components play an important role in controlling daily stress and strain. 

Mitragyna javanica is also known as Kra Thum Na which is another feature leading to confusion between m hirsuta and m javanica. It is going to be a worthwhile experience for first-time consumers or users.

The main difference between Mitragyna hirsuta and Mitragyna javanica is its effects. Mitragyna hirsuta is known to have a strong effect on certain dosage levels whereas Mitragyna javanica shows mild effects even in high dosage consumption.
